Watch Ryan Reynolds Explain What He Smuggled Across the Border For Wife Blake Lively

If Ryan Reynolds and Blake Lively weren't already your #relationshipgoals then this might just get you over the line.

During an interview on The Graham Norton Show, the 39-year-old Canadian actor explained how he almost got caught smuggling apple pie across the US border for his wife.

Ryan explained how his "foodie" wife loves these particular apple pies that you get in Ryan’s hometown, Vancouver, Canada so he grabbed a couple to take home. However it's illegal to take fruit and vegetables across the border and because he's a terrible liar he got caught out.

“My voice always gets really high when I’m lying. He’s like, ‘You got anything, any sort of fruit, any vegetables in there?’ And I was like, ‘Nooooo. Noooooo.’ I go, ‘That’s crazy!’ And basically he just had me on the hook,” he said.

However luckily for Ryan, the officer was a fan and instead requested a personal performance from one of his classic films, Just Friends.

"He looks at me and he goes, ‘Hey, you remember that movie you did? That movie Just Friends?" Reynolds said.

"He was like, 'You know that song at the end of it where you sing 'I Swear’ by All-4-One?' And I was like, 'Yeah, yeah.' And he’s like, 'Yeah, yeah. Go ahead.' Basically he was saying, 'Dance, monkey.'"

And so what did Ryan do?

"I danced. Oh man, I sang that thing in the best falsetto I have, and I was on my way through the border, eating pie by the next stop.'"
